Since 2014, Simplestream, a leading provider of video services for the media and entertainment industry, has been working with the experts at digital video solutions provider Garland and multi-screen encoder/transcoder provider Media Excel to expand their offerings to their customers.

Simplestream provides OTT Live and VoD streaming solutions, including fully automated catch-up services for desktop, mobile, tablet and TV. They have a diverse customer base, which includes shopping channels, horse racing, gaming, sport, news and entertainment. Ever the innovator, at IBC 2017 in Amsterdam running from 15-19 September, they will be unveiling their enhanced suite of modular cloud-based solutions, including the official launch of “VOD-in-a-Box”, Network PVR and enhanced live video editor (you can find them on stand #14.D11).

Media Excel’s product line has been developed in line with the needs of Simplestream’s customers and their own white label live, on demand and catch-up offering.  Earlier this year, Garland supplied Simplestream with Media Excel HERO 1RU platforms with the HERO Management System running in the cloud. Each HERO is running five services that are encoded in adaptive bitrates and in multiple formats.

In turn, Simplestream was able to assist urban music and entertainment company, Trace, in building its new SVoD, live TV and radio offering called TracePlay. In less than 12 week, Simplestream had completed the project, which includes content ingest, transcoding and service management.

Trace, based in Paris, offers direct and live access to 10 music and sports TV channels, 31 FM and digital urban music radio stations, and a selection of urban TV series, films and documentaries. Its audience spawns across 80 countries —  from Africa to Europe, the United States, the Caribbean and Indian Ocean — and is scheduled to expand to 200 countries.

  “We saw many advantages to this encoding platform,” says Lorna Garrett, Commercial Director at Garland. “Not only does it offer a wide set of features, but it is an excellent means to future proof through the use of HEVC encoding and 4K/UHD.” 

“TracePlay is a great example of a truly global offering: it is multi-device, multi-lingual and it appeals to a huge audience in more than 200 countries,” says Dan Finch, Chief Commercial Officer of Simplestream. “By working together with Garland, Media Excel and our customer on such a highly complex project, we were able to provide the needed solution fast, as well as the support needed. In turn, we all were able to grow our offerings and our expertise.”
